Home > Shows > Morning Glory > Morning Glory with Esmeralda (25/05/2022) > Morning Glory See All Episodes Morning Glory with Esmeralda (25/05/2022) Soho Radio • May 25, 2022 Esmeralda sits in for James Endeacott playing a mix Latin, Rnb, House and Jazz. Listen SHARE :